How does the OBC creamy layer impact reservations in India
An analysis of the OBC creamy layer and its effects on the reservation system.
- The OBC creamy layer refers to the relatively well-off individuals within the Other Backward Classes (OBC) category who are excluded from reservation benefits.
- Its impact on reservations in India includes criticism that the benefits of reservations intended for disadvantaged OBC members may not reach those who are economically and socially advanced.
- This exclusion of the creamy layer aims to ensure that reservation benefits reach the most marginalized sections within the OBC community.
- However, critics argue that defining the creamy layer based solely on income criteria may not address the underlying socio-economic disparities effectively.
- Efforts are ongoing to revise and ensure fair implementation of the creamy layer criteria to enhance the efficacy of reservation systems in India.
